Q: Is 606,332,229 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 606,332,229 is a composite number.

Why is 606,332,229 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 606,332,229 can be evenly divided by 1 3 109 327 1,854,227 5,562,681 202,110,743 and 606,332,229, with no remainder.

Since 606,332,229 cannot be divided by just 1 and 606,332,229, it is a composite number.
